fluentd-kubernetes-sumologic with self-signed certificate
How do i use the fluentd.daemonset.yaml on a kubernetes-HA setup with self-signed master certificates? I am seeing this in the fluentd container logs: 2017-04-26T22:17:54.834724228Z 2017-04-26 22:17:54 +0000 [error]: config error file="/fluentd/etc/fluent.conf" error="Invalid Kubernetes API v1 endpoint https://10.0.0.1:443/api: SSL_connect returned=1 errno=0 state=SSLv3 read server certificate B: certificate verify failed" Does the service account (and associated secret mounts) need to be set up? Which namespace does this run in, kube-system, or doesn't matter. Thanks! -Ian
